Transaction

aed32bebbf9b2eb06167275f4584c0497746519995760a30e53b27bb96ccedec

Summary

In Block260213
TimeSat, 08 Jul 2023 12:44:15 UTC
Total Input694.08045603 Nebula
Total Output749.08045603 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
706891 Confirmations749.08045603 Nebula
Raw Transaction